Life gets complicated. Things demand our attention~ I rush around throwing the laundry in while I’m emptying the dishwasher all while in pursuit of my agenda…
IF I’m not careful, all those mundane tasks take a great deal of my time IF I am unconscious or ‘asleep’. I’d rather be doing something else. Time is always on my mind and my own character is being formed with the choices I make. Here is the thing: Bringing mindfulness to the task keeps you awake.
Remembering to breathe and ask for clarity brings a sense of the sacred to the mindlessness. It is not always easy to remember, but as I practice listening it starts to become second nature. I am practicing slowing down…. and when I can’t (being single handed mama that I am), I ask for inner direction, some help please… to look and really SEE and listen and really HEAR.
